Why Your First Deposit Might Vanish (Before You Even Play)

Many new players rush through registration, enticed by flashy welcome bonuses promising £50 free or 100% deposit matches. They complete the aviator game website sign up, fund their account, and... nothing. The bonus disappears. Or worse, their withdrawal gets frozen.

Here’s why: wagering requirements. A typical offer might state "£20 bonus, 40x wagering." That means you must bet £800 (£20 x 40) before cashing out any winnings from that bonus. Aviator’s fast rounds tempt rapid betting—but each £1 spin counts toward that £800 total. If you lose before hitting it, the bonus funds evaporate.

UK-licensed sites must display these terms clearly, but they’re often buried in tiny print. Always check the "Bonus Terms" link during sign-up. Better yet, consider skipping the bonus entirely. Opting out during registration (a checkbox usually appears) lets you withdraw real-money winnings instantly, no strings attached.

What Others Won’t Tell You

Most guides gloss over critical pitfalls. Don’t become another statistic. Here’s what they omit:

  • KYC Isn’t Optional—It’s Instant: Under U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) rules, operators must verify your identity before allowing withdrawals. Some sites trigger this after your first deposit; others wait until you request a payout. Either way, have a colour scan of your passport or driving licence and a recent utility bill ready. Delays here cause 90% of "missing withdrawal" complaints.
  • Self-Exclusion is Binding: During aviator game website sign up, you’ll see links to GambleAware and set deposit limits. If you activate a cooling-off period (24h-7 days) or self-exclusion (6 months+), it applies across all UKGC-licensed sites via the GAMSTOP register. You cannot bypass it by signing up elsewhere.
  • IP Address Lockdown: UK sites block access from restricted regions using IP detection. Using a VPN? Your account will be flagged, funds frozen, and you risk permanent closure. The UKGC mandates geo-location compliance—no exceptions.
  • Payment Method = Verification Tier: Depositing via PayPal or Skrill often speeds up KYC because these services pre-verify your identity. Bank transfers or prepaid cards? Expect manual document checks, adding 24-72 hours to processing.
  • "Fairness" Certificates are Audited Monthly: Reputable sites publish RNG (Random Number Generator) certificates from labs like e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Check the footer for "Provably Fair" or "RNG Certified" seals. If absent, walk away.

The Hidden Cost of "Free" Bets

That £10 "risk-free" bet offer? It often comes with brutal fine print. Example: "Place a £10 bet on Aviator at odds of 1.50+. Get £10 bonus if it loses." Sounds simple. But:

  • The "odds" refer to your cash-out multiplier. Betting £10 and cashing out at 1.20x? Doesn’t count.
  • Bonus funds expire in 7 days—plenty of time to lose them chasing unrealistic multipliers.
  • Winnings from bonus bets are capped (e.g., "max £100 win from bonus").

During aviator game website sign up, screenshot the full terms. Compare them against sites like LeoVegas, which offers straightforward deposit matches with clearer wagering (e.g., "35x on bonus only").

Responsible Play Isn’t a Checkbox—It’s Your Safety Net

The UKGC mandates tools to prevent harm. During aviator game website sign up, you’ll configure:

  • Deposit Limits: Set daily/weekly/monthly caps (£10-£10,000). Changes take 24h to apply—plan ahead.
  • Session Reminders: Alerts every 30/60/90 minutes. Crucial for Aviator’s rapid gameplay (rounds last 5-30 seconds).
  • Reality Checks: Pop-ups showing session duration and net loss. Enable these—they combat the "just one more round" trap.

Ignoring these turns Aviator from entertainment into a financial hazard. The game’s design exploits dopamine spikes; your settings are the counterbalance.

Withdrawal Nightmares: How Sign-Up Choices Backfire

Your aviator game website sign up method directly impacts cashouts:

  • Using Cryptocurrency? Sites like Stake.com process crypto withdrawals in minutes. But UKGC-licensed sites rarely accept crypto due to traceability issues. Stick to GBP via Visa, Mastercard, or e-wallets (PayPal, Skrill) for legal protection.
  • Different Withdrawal Method: UK rules require "closed-loop" payments—you must withdraw to the same method used for deposit. Deposit via Skrill? Withdrawals go back to Skrill. No exceptions.
  • Incomplete Profile: Missing address line 2 or postcode typo during sign-up? Withdrawals halt until corrected. Double-check every field.

Average withdrawal times on UK sites: e-wallets (under 24h), cards (1-3 days), bank transfers (3-5 days). Anything longer warrants a support ticket.

Is aviator game website sign up legal in the UK?

Yes, but only on sites holding a valid U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) license. Verify the license number in the website footer matches the UKGC's public register. Avoid unlicensed offshore sites—they offer no legal recourse for disputes.

How long does KYC verification take after sign-up?

On UKGC-licensed sites, KYC typically completes within 24-48 hours if you submit clear, colour documents (passport/driving licence + utility bill/bank statement). Delays occur with blurry images, expired IDs, or mismatched names.

Can I use a VPN to sign up for Aviator sites?

No. UK-licensed operators use geolocation to block VPN/proxy users. Attempting to bypass this violates terms of service, leading to account termination and forfeiture of funds. Access must originate from a UK IP address.

What’s the minimum age to sign up?

You must be 18 or older. Age verification is part of KYC—submitting false information is illegal under the UK Gambling Act 2005 and voids all winnings.

Do I need to claim a welcome bonus during sign-up?

No. Most sites let you opt out of bonuses via a checkbox during registration. Skipping bonuses avoids wagering requirements, letting you withdraw real-money winnings immediately. Always review bonus terms before accepting.

Why was my withdrawal rejected after winning?

Common reasons include: incomplete KYC, attempting to withdraw to a different payment method than deposited, exceeding self-imposed limits, or triggering fraud checks (e.g., unusual betting patterns). Contact support with your account details for specifics.

Are Aviator game results truly random?

On UKGC-licensed sites, yes. These platforms use certified RNGs audited monthly by independent labs (e.g., eCOGRA). Look for "RNG Certificate" links in the site footer. Unlicensed sites may manipulate outcomes—avoid them.
